Ronnie Milsap Announces Birthday Tour

The 76 for 76 Tour will swing through Cincinnati next April.

(Nashville, TN)  --  Ronnie Milsap is celebrating his upcoming birthday with a new tour. 

The Country Music Hall of Fame member is turning 76-years-old on January 16th.  He's kicking off his 76 for 76 Tour that night in Nashville. 

Milsap's pop-country hits including “Any Day Now,” “Stranger in My House” and “(There’s) No Gettin’ Over Me.”

Tickets for the first wave of stops are on sale now.
